Output 376619653c622aec63a510773bef4fda4b6d3ceae6af31645ad107aa387d2554:0

value
347140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a41680bed4f91282e6fe69bdbf603747199a03f0 OP_EQUAL
address
3GedhXuWyTM6iJ4E1L1ojCjJRMmbtVdaV1
transaction
376619653c622aec63a510773bef4fda4b6d3ceae6af31645ad107aa387d2554
confirmations
188567
spent
true